Systematic name YDR524C
Gene name AGE1
Aliases SAT1
Feature type ORF, Verified
Coordinates Chr IV:1488983..1487535
Primary SGDID S000002932


Description of YDR524C: ADP-ribosylation factor (ARF) GTPase activating protein (GAP) effector, involved in the secretory and endocytic pathways; contains C2C2H2 cysteine/histidine motif[1][2]
